Research Acute Care Physical Therapist Job Trends in Ontario

If you’re a Acute Care Physical Therapist curious about Travel job trends in Ontario, OR, AMN Healthcare has successfully filled 3 similar positions in the area, providing insight into the opportunities you could expect. These previously filled roles offered competitive pay, with an average weekly rate of $1,585 and a range from $1,449 to $1,711 per week, showcasing the strong earning potential for professionals in this field.

Positions were located in key zip codes, including 97914, at reputable facilities such as Trinity – St. Alphonsus Medical Center – Ontario. These placements reflect the high demand for skilled Acute Physical Therapists in Ontario’s thriving healthcare landscape. What Types of Work and Facilities Can Acute Physical Therapists Expect in Ontario, OR?

As a Physical Therapist specializing in Acute Care in Ontario, Oregon, you can expect a diverse and dynamic work environment in a range of healthcare settings. In this role, you may find yourself working in hospitals, rehabilitation centers, and outpatient clinics, where you will provide vital rehabilitation services to patients recovering from surgeries, injuries, and acute medical conditions. Your responsibilities will include conducting thorough assessments, developing personalized treatment plans, and implementing therapeutic interventions aimed at improving mobility, strength, and overall functional abilities. Collaborating closely with multidisciplinary teams, you will play a crucial role in facilitating patient recovery and discharge planning, ensuring that each individual receives comprehensive care tailored to their unique needs in a supportive community atmosphere.
